The Role
Our Consultant Addictions Psychiatrists provide leadership, expert advice and direction to the service to ensure that service users consistently receive high quality services that adhere to best practice guidelines and achieve high professional standards.
As part of our Senior Management Team, you will contribute to the overall performance of the service to ensure that contractual output targets are achieved. You will record and input client data and information in order that the service operates within contractual, administrative and financial requirements.
Responsibilities
* Provide a clinical assessment, including relevant psychiatric and physical investigation and reviews, of a wide range of substance misusers presenting to the service.
* Operate within guidelines, policies and procedures relevant to the post.
* Conduct phlebotomy tests and support nursing team in ensuring that the maximum number of service users are tested for BBVs and vaccinated against Hepatitis A and B.
* Attend multidisciplinary meetings as appropriate.
* Participate in continuing professional development, annual appraisal and revalidation and join appropriate supervision and PDP groups for the role.
* Work in partnership with users and carers so that they are fully involved in and empowered to make decisions about their treatment and care.
* Remain up to date on professional developments as required by their professional body.
About You
* Medical Degree and completion of Basic Medical Training and Full GMC UK Registration with License to Practice.
* Good knowledge of addiction psychiatry and legislation relating to Mental Health.
* Understanding of the work of other agencies including non‑statutory services.
* Experience of working with substance misuse and mental health issues and a clear understanding of the need for and ability to deliver quality services.
* Capacity to work alone and keep calm under pressure.
